Website Saint Charles Catholic School Spokane, Washington
St. Charles is a parish school offering a Catholic classical liberal arts education for students from Montessori through 8th grade. Rooted in the mission of the Church, we seek to form students in faith, reason, and virtue—pursuing the True, the Good, and the Beautiful in all things.
MISSION
St. Charles Catholic School is a parish apostolate faithful to the Church’s mission of spreading the gospel, living a sacramental life and seeking the Truth, Goodness and Beauty that is woven by the Creator into His creation.
VISION
St. Charles Catholic School is a visible expression of the Church’s mission to “go and teach all nations.” St. Charles Catholic School grounds its students in Gospel values, Scripture, Catholic social teachings, and Catholic traditions as they grow in a personal relationship with God: Father, Son and Spirit. St. Charles School challenges students academically in all areas of the curriculum while recognizing the uniqueness and abilities of each member of the school community. It inspires students to become lifelong learners, responsible decision-makers and active members of the Church and community. Recognizing that parents have the primary responsibility for educating their children spiritually, physically, socially, emotionally and intellectually, St. Charles Catholic School supports parents in that responsibility.
In the Gospel message, we are taught that Jesus came to teach all people and that God wills all to be saved and come to the knowledge of the truth. St. Charles Catholic School is an institution which, above all, strives to proclaim and live this message. With this in mind, St. Charles Catholic School will admit children, regardless of religious belief, race, color, national and ethnic origin, handicap or financial situation.
The Opportunity
Seeking a faithful, inspiring, and visionary Principal to lead our community in its mission
of academic excellence, spiritual formation, and joyful discipleship.
Key Responsibilities
Serve as the spiritual, academic, and operational leader of the school.
Advance the school’s role in the evangelizing mission of the parish under the pastor’s
guidance.
Lead and mentor faculty, fostering authentic classical pedagogy and professional growth.
Communicate clearly and compassionately with staff, students, families, and supporters.
Promote community engagement and cultivate enrollment and donor support.
Manage budgeting and school operations with prudence and transparency.
Be an active presence at school and parish events, nurturing a faith-filled, vibrant
community.
Support extracurricular programs that enrich student life.
Ideal Candidate
Models a joyful life of faith and servant leadership.
Is deeply committed to Catholic teaching and classical education.
Demonstrates excellence in communication, collaboration, and administration.
Brings experience in Catholic education and the ability to guide and inspire faculty
Holds or is pursuing Washington State Administrative Certification (or equivalent)
